O R D E R
This writ petition has been filed to quash the order, dated 6/4/2016, passed by the second respondent in Ref.Rc.No.13479/Cane.1/2015. Page No:2/4
2. Heard Mr.Simran Srinivasan, learned counsel for the petitioner, Mr.P.Sathish, learned Additional Government Pleader for the respondents 1 to 3 and Mr.R.Balaramesh, learned counsel for the fourth respondent. There is no appearance on behalf of the fifth respondent.
3. Today, when the matter is taken up for hearing, learned Additional Government Pleader appearing for the respondents 1 to 3 submitted that the Government have examined the proposal of the Director of Sugar and based on the 50th Area Delimitation Committee Meeting, decided to accept the same. He has produced G.O.(Ms) No.244, dated 5/10/2018, and further submitted that G.O., has been implemented successfully. Therefore, question of challenging the delimitation does not arise at all. Hence, prays for dismissal of the writ petition.
4. The learned Additional Government Pleader produced the copy of G.O.(Ms) No.244, dated 5/10/2018 and Proceedings of the Commissioner of Sugar and Cane Commissioner, Chennai, dated 30/11/2018. Page No:3/4
N. SATHISH KUMAR, J mvs.
5. As the delimitation has been refixed and implemented by the Government, instant writ petition has become infructuous. No costs. Consequently, the connected Miscellaneous Petition is closed. 28/11/2022 Index : Yes / No Internet: Yes Speaking/non speaking order mvs.
